Style: A modern take on traditional Nevisian style – a canary yellow clapboard house with white and jade trim and a tin roof. Brightly coloured timber-frame interior with louvered windows and doors that open out to give a very liveable tropical home
The Beach: Villas close to Nevis beaches are rare. Sandpiper is just two minutes walk across the road from Oualie Beach. There is a pool (24ft by 12ft) set in a wooden deck in the garden
The Rooms: Four bedrooms, two with queen sized beds (one with en suite bathroom), one with three single beds, a twin room downstairs with en suite
Key features: Nevis Sandpiper villa rental: four-bedroom Nevis villa, full kitchen with large fridge-freezer with toaster, coffee maker and dishwasher, sitting room with TV, CD and cassette player, dial up internet, swimming pool, barbecue.
Children: Welcome, though the pool cannot be fenced
Staff: There is maid service three mornings a week

 
Useful Hints
Vervet monkeys often roam freely around the property. This provides entertainment, but be aware that they are wild animals and so you should not attempt to approach them or feed them.

The first night’s meal, essential breakfast provisions and some beverages are offered complimentary with all complete house bookings. Additional shopping with no service charge is also offered. Rental rates for villas do not include 'tips' about which you will find advice in the guest information book at the villa.

Getting Around
A hire car is strongly recommended for all private villa holidays. You will need it for exploring the island and visiting the beaches by day and the restaurants in the evenings. You can ask the rental agent to arrange a car for you. It can be delivered to the property and the rental company will issue your Nevisian driving licence (price US$25) at the same time. Alternatively we can recommend
TDC Thrifty Car Rentals. For a small fee vehicles can be returned at the airport or be collected from the property at a pre-arranged time on your departure day. Be aware that over Christmas, February and even in August there can be a shortage of cars on Nevis, so you are advised to book well in advance.
